python对列表进行永久性或临时排序的方法

  • 更新时间:2021-08-03 09:00:28
  • 编辑:梁俊拔
为找教程的网友们整理了相关的编程文章,网友魏萦思根据主题投稿了本篇教程内容,涉及到Python相关内容,已被872网友关注,如果对知识点想更进一步了解可以在下方电子资料中获取。

参考资料

正文内容

本页是码农之家最新发布的《python对列表进行永久性或临时排序的方法》的详细页面,实例讲的很实用,把错误代码改掉了,觉得好就请收藏下。

python对列表进行永久性或临时排序的方法

python对列表进行永久性或临时排序的方法

1、对列表进行永久性排序:使用方法 sort() 

sort() 方法:用于将列表中的元素进行排序。默认按升序排列。

也可以向 sort() 方法传递参数 reverse = True 反向排序。

num = [22,11,45,520,987,8]
num.sort()
print(num)
num.sort(reverse=True)
print(num)

输出

[8, 11, 22, 45, 520, 987]
[987, 520, 45, 22, 11, 8]

2、对列表进行临时排序:使用方法 sorted() 

要保留列表元素原来的排列顺序,同时以特定的顺序呈现它们,它使用函数 sorted()。

该函数能够按特定顺序显示列表元素,同时不影响它们在列表中的原始排列排序。

cars = ['bmw','audi','toyota','subaru']
print('Here is the original list:',cars)
print('Here is the sorted list:',sorted(cars))
Here is the original list: ['bmw', 'audi', 'toyota', 'subaru']
Here is the sorted list: ['audi', 'bmw', 'subaru', 'toyota']

相关教程

用户留言